配列は一般的に使用され、PHPで重要なデータ型があります。実際の開発では、アレイ内の値を操作する必要があることがよくあります。 array_values()関数は、すべての値を配列内で取得し、新しいインデックス付き配列を返すことができる実用的なツールです。
この関数の基本的な構文は次のとおりです。
array_values(array $ array):array
パラメーター説明:
<?php // 連想配列を定義します $student = [ "name" => 「チャン・サン」、 「年齢」=> 18、 「性別」=>「男性」 ]; // array_values()関数を使用して、array $ values = array_values($ sustent)で値を得るします。 //新しいしいインデックス配列print_r($ values)を印刷します。 ?>
配列 ( [0] => Zhang San [1] => 18 [2] =>男性)
上記の例からわかるように、array_values()関数は、連想配列内のすべての値を抽出し、新しいインデックス配列を生成します。新しい配列のキーは0から始まり、シーケンスで増分しますが、元の配列のキーは破棄されます。
この関数は、キー名を気にせずに配列値を処理する必要がある場合に使用するのに適しており、配列値の操作プロセスを大幅に簡素化します。
array_values()は、配列値を取得するためにPHPの便利な機能です。データの再編成であろうと価値のトラバーサル処理であろうと、開発者はクリーンで継続的にインデックス付きの配列値リストを迅速に取得し、コードのシンプルさと効率を改善するのに役立ちます。